On Thursday 02 December 2021, Jan Ebert, Helmholtz AI consultant from the Jülich Supercomputing Centre, will present a seminar about JAX is for Joy, Autodiff, and Xeleration - Introduction and deep dive into a GPU-compatible NumPy and SciPy replacement.
Steve Schmerler, Helmholtz AI consultant @ HZDR will chair the session.

The Helmholtz AI FFT (food for thought) seminar series aims to facilitate knowledge exchange within the Helmholtz AI community (researchers and consultants) and the formation of topic-related interest groups within Helmholtz AI.
The seminars take place the first Thursday of each month, from 11:00 to 12:00, and consist of a 40-min lecture + 20-min Q&A (facilitated via hackmd).
